POSITION SUMMARY
CVS Health Digital is looking for hands‑on, passionate people who want to join a high energy and growing team to make a difference in customers' lives and who want to be on the forefront of digital innovation that aims to reinvent what a pharmacy and a health care company can be in the digital world. Currently, we are seeking a Senior Software Development Engineer with deep expertise in Java/JEE, Spring Boot, RESTful microservices, and Kafka to lead the design and development of scalable, secure cloud‑native solutions. This role requires hands‑on experience with Data Migration, ETL pipelines, and data management best practices, ideally in a Healthcare/EHR integration context. The ideal candidate brings strong engineering rigor, leadership presence, architectural insight, and a modern SecDevOps mindset. Experience with GCP and healthcare data standards (HL7, FHIR) is highly preferred.

Software Engineering & Architecture

Architect, design and develop high‑performance microservices using Java, JEE, Spring Boot, and Spring Cloud

Lead development of event‑driven services using Apache Kafka (producers, consumers, streaming patterns, schema evolution)

Own API strategy for RESTful services, ensuring consistent JSON modeling, backward‑compatible versioning, and strong API governance

Mentor team members and contribute to engineering standards, design reviews, and coding best practices

Data Migration, ETL, and Data Management

Design and implement ETL pipelines for structured/unstructured data using tools such as Python‑based pipelines, Spring Batch, or cloud‑native ETL frameworks

Lead data migration efforts for legacy‑to‑cloud or system‑to‑system transitions (incremental loads, bulk loads, validation, reconciliation)

Establish data quality, profiling, and governance practices

Work with clinical data formats, mapping, transformations, and normalization (FHIR resources, HL7 v2 segments, CCD/C‑CDA documents)

Cloud, DevOps & SecDevOps

Build and maintain CI/CD automation (unit tests, integration tests, SAST/DAST, artifact provenance, policy gates)

Deploy and operate services on Google Cloud Platform (GCP) using GKE, Cloud Run, Cloud Build, Cloud SQL, Pub/Sub, IAM, Secret Manager, etc

Drive SecDevOps practices: threat modeling, secure coding, dependency scanning, secrets management, container hardening

Implement observability frameworks (OpenTelemetry, tracing, dashboards, alerts, SLOs)

Healthcare/EHR Integration

Integrate microservices with EHR systems using HL7 v2, FHIR, SMART on FHIR, and standard healthcare APIs

Support workflows across patient data exchange, interoperability, and HIPAA‑aligned data flows

Collaborate with compliance and security teams to implement regulatory safeguards
